Outside help may be needed in probe into indecent posts by MCMC Twitter account

Datuk Saifuddin Abdullah says special committee faces hurdles as some suspects no longer work with commission

MCMC’s Twitter account was temporarily suspended after uproar in January over certain posts. – Pixabay pic, April 23, 2021

PUTRAJAYA – The Communications and Multimedia Ministry may need the assistance of external authorities to complete the investigation into indecent posts by the Malaysian Communications and Multimedia Commission’s (MCMC) Twitter account, said Datuk Saifuddin Abdullah.

The minister said a special committee has conducted an in-depth probe, but faces constraints as some of the individuals allegedly involved in the matter are no longer working with MCMC.

“I have seen the report. The committee has carried out a comprehensive and in-depth investigation.

“However, the committee faces some challenges, as some of the people allegedly involved are no longer working with MCMC, and the committee has no jurisdiction to investigate them.

“So, I have instructed the ministry’s secretary-general, Datuk Seri Mohammad Mentek, to look into the possibility of seeking help from authorities outside the ministry to resolve this problem,” he told the media after a virtual engagement session with leading technology companies, namely Google, Microsoft, Facebook and Amazon, here today.

There was uproar in January over certain tweets by the MCMC account, leading to its temporary suspension. – Bernama, April 23, 2021
